cove is seeking a passionate and forward-thinking Software Engineer who thrives on solving complex technical challenges and is eager to push the boundaries of AI-driven 3D applications. Join cove, the world’s first AI-powered, human-centered architecture firm, and help redefine how architects design, collaborate, and lead in the age of intelligent technology.
Key Responsibilities:
Foster a culture of technical excellence and collaboration through code reviews, knowledge sharing, and engineering best practices in an agile environment
Design and implement scalable back-end and front-end systems that power our platform
Work with 3D geometry libraries to create performant, interactive features for CAD and BIM applications
Integrate AI/ML models into user-facing applications, focusing on geometry, optimization, and design automation
Drive technical decisions and contribute to the long-term technical vision of the platform
Design and implement robust backend services and APIs that support complex 3D geometry workflows and AEC data models
Integrate and deploy AI/ML models into production, with a focus on geometry processing, design optimization, and automation
Monitor AI model performance in production using observability and model telemetry practices, identifying regressions, drift, and opportunities to improve reliability
Work with 3D geometry and computational geometry libraries to build performant, scalable features
Participate in code reviews and architectural discussions, helping shape the technical direction of the platform
Contribute to an agile engineering culture — iterating quickly, communicating clearly, and shipping with confidence
Qualifications:
Required:
2+ years of professional full stack and/or backend software engineering experience
Proficiency in Python and experience building production-grade APIs and services
Hands-on experience integrating AI/ML models into backend systems
Working knowledge of 3D or computational geometry concepts
Experience with relational and/or NoSQL databases
Experience with cloud infrastructure, containerization, and deployment pipelines
Nice to Have:
Experience with 3D web technologies: Three.js, React Three Fiber
Familiarity with real-time data or messaging systems
Exposure to MLOps practices and model monitoring tooling
Familiarity with BIM and/or CAD workflows, data formats, or tooling (e.g. IFC, Revit, Rhino, or similar)
Background or strong interest in the AEC industry
